Maumee Mayor to Deliver Second State of the City Address

MAUMEE, Ohio — The City of Maumee has announced that Mayor Jim MacDonald will deliver the 2025 State of the City address for a second time next week. The address will be presented at 6:30 p.m. on February 4 at the Maumee Indoor Theater. Doors will open at 6:00 p.m., and the event is free and open to the public.

This second presentation of the State of the City address is aimed at providing an opportunity for residents who were unable to attend the first one to hear directly from the mayor. The original address was delivered on January 21 at the Maumee Chamber of Commerce luncheon.

During the address, Mayor MacDonald is expected to highlight several key economic development projects that are underway for 2025, as well as discuss goals and initiatives he has introduced since taking office.
